Infectious Diseases division to offer clinical research courses

Both programs will be held at the U of L Clinical and Translational Research Building, 505 South Hancock Street.

The University of Louisville Division of Infectious Diseases will once again be offering courses to health care workers interested in a basic and concise review of the methodology for clinical research.

"The Principles of Clinical and Translational Research" will span over two weeks beginning August 6, 2012, at the University of Louisville Clinical and Translational Research Building (505 South Hancock Street).

The sessions will be directed by Dr. Julio Ramirez, Chief of the U of L Division of Infectious Diseases, and Dr. Colleen Jonsson, Director of the Center for Predictive Medicine for Biodefense and Emerging Infectious Diseases.

Reviewing the process of Clinical and Translational Research from generation of the research idea to publication of the study manuscript is the primary goal of the course.

In addition, a special symposium, "Clinical and Translational Research in Infectious Diseases" will be held from 7 a.m. - 7 p.m. Friday, August 24, also at the Clinical and Translational Research Building.

Cost of the entire course is $100 per participant for the 28 hours of instruction. To obtain the final diploma, participants must attend a minimum of 75% of the classes.

Scholarships are available through the Division of Infectious Diseases.
